Audio-Technicas fourth-generation 3000 Series wireless system
Providing easy setup, versatile operation and rock-solid, richly detailed high-fidelity sound, Audio-Technicas fourth-generation 3000 Series wireless systems give users the power and flexibility to operate within the congested UHF spectrum.
“60 MHz tuning range”With a class-leading 60 MHz tuning range more than twice that offered by the previous versions the new 3000 Series systems are available in four frequency bands DE2 (470530 MHz), EE1 (530590 MHz), EF1 (590650 MHz) and FG1 (650700 MHz). Frequencies can be easily scanned and selected on the receiver and then synced with the transmitter via IR sync functionality. The 3000 Series even lets users set a backup frequency that can be quickly swapped by pressing the transmitters multifunction button in the event of unexpected interference.

This system configuration features an ATW-R3210 receiver and ATW-T3201 body-pack transmitter with BP892cH-TH MicroSet (beige) omnidirectional condenser headworn microphone. Includes element covers, windscreens and clothing clip. The ATW-T3201 is equipped with Audio-Technicas new cH-style screw-down 4-pin connector for secure connection to Audio-Technicas cH-style lavalier and headworn microphones, or cables. The transmitter features rugged, metal housings and is powered by two AA batteries. Charging terminals on the transmitter work with the ATW-CHG3 and networkable ATW-CHG3N smart charging docks (sold separately) to recharge NiMH batteries. Antenna power is available for powered antennas and other in-line RF devices. A ground-lift switch helps eliminate audible hum caused by ground loops. The system features balanced and unbalanced audio output jacks.
